Moving costs for this long-distance route range from $1,947 to $2,688 depending on the size of your move. Small moves typically cost between $1,947 and $2,068, medium moves range from $2,239 to $2,378, and large moves fall between $2,531 and $2,688. Prices vary due to factors such as distance, home size, packing services, and delivery timing.

Standard delivery usually takes about 5 days, while expedited options can reduce this to 4 days, depending on the moving company and scheduling.
Choosing a smaller shipment size, flexible delivery dates, and self-packing can help reduce costs. However, full-service moves offer convenience at a higher price.
Booking at least several weeks in advance is recommended to secure better rates and availability, especially during peak moving seasons.
Yes, moving companies operating between states must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ance and protection.
Plan for longer transit times, coordinate packing and unpacking schedules, and consider storage options if needed. Communication with your moving company is key for a smooth process.
